#bf56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f56ed is composed of 74.9% red, 33.7%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.4% cyan, 63.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 281.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 63.3%. #bf56ed color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#7f00db.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#bf56ed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f56ed has RGB values of R:191, G:86,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 12539629.

Shades and Tints of #bf56ed
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060108 is the darkest color, while #fbf6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f56ed
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a39ea5 is the less saturated color, while #c548fb is the most saturated one.
